Graphic Design Specialist


Job Classification: Part-Time, Non-Exempt

Reports to: Graphic Design and Creative Manager

Position Summary

The Graphic Design Specialist works under the direction of the Graphic Design and Creative Manager and assists in the design and production of graphic art and visual materials for print and digital media. Ensures that layout and design are aligned with brand and production standards and follow best practices. Assists in the creation and execution of design solutions including imagery, charts, infographics, and multimedia elements used for marketing, advertising, sales, and others forms of communication.

  • Education and Experience

  • Bachelors’ degree preferred in Graphic Arts, Advertising, Marketing or related field.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in graphic/web design projects or equivalent combinations of education and experience.
  • Must be proficient in Adobe Creative Suite - primarily Photoshop, Illustrator, and Premier Pro
  • Must be proficient in Final Cut Pro
  • Knowledge of other graphic design and publishing tools including Canva, Stripo, etc.
  • Experience in creating graphics/video for social media
  • Strong ver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ills.
  • Excellent PC skills, including Microsoft Office products.
  • Excellent attention to details.
  • Demonstrate knowledge and experience in print production process and how it affects design.
